Clustered Beans Lentil Crumble / Kothavarangai Paruppu Usuli

Kothavarangai Paruppu UsuliParuppu Usuli is a traditional brahmin recipe. It is dhal crumbles on the vegetable like Kothavarangai (clustered Beans) or a beans. This dhal crumbles gives a wonderful flavor to this curry. This will go very well with Moor Kuzhambu.

Ingredients:

Kothavarangai(Clustered Beans)1/2 Kg
SaltTo Taste


For Seasoning:
Oil1 Teaspoon
Mustard Seeds1 Teaspoon
Urdhal1 teaspoon


For Grinding:
Thurdal3/4 cup
Channa Dal1/4 Cup
SaltTo Taste
HingA Pinch
Red Chilli2


Method:
  • Soak the Dal's in water over night or for at least 2 hours
  • Finely chop the Kothavarangai(Clustered Beans) and keep it aside
  • Rinse the Dal's and strain the water and grind it in mixer once along with red chilli, hing and salt
  • The ground mixture should not be so smooth.
  • Heat the oil in the pan, and add the ground paste and keep the flame in low
  • Allow the ground paste to cook in oil and it will broke down into smaller pieces.
  • In a separate pan, heat some oil and add mustard seeds when the oil is hot.
  • When the mustard seeds starts to sputter, add the urdhal and fry till it turns into golden brown color.
  • To this add chopped Kothavarangai(Clustered Beans) along with salt and sprinkle some water to cook the Kothavarangai(Clustered Beans)
  • When the Kothavarangai(Clustered Beans) is cooked completely, add the broken Dal mixture and mix it well
  • The mouth-watering Kothavarangai(Clustered Beans) paruppu usuli is ready to serve.
  • Kothavarangai(Clustered Beans) paruppu usuli is a very good side dish for Moorkuzhambu.Kothavarangai Paruppu Usuli
